Transaction 2513231fa9563b766569bf4830c632a5bc76874e1340a48942e73dc44ae4f970
1 Input
2 Outputs
- 2513231fa9563b766569bf4830c632a5bc76874e1340a48942e73dc44ae4f970:0
- 2513231fa9563b766569bf4830c632a5bc76874e1340a48942e73dc44ae4f970:1
value 108513
address 3P2xXyj9nmVZJcPgRZE1oYQfYnb63riQvp
value 999731
address 16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y